ÖZETBASIM ENDÜSTRİSİNDE SÜRDÜRÜLEBİLİRLİK YAKLAŞIMI: KARTON ETİKET ÜRETİMİ ÜZERİNE BİR ÇALIŞMASanayi devrimi ile başlayıp devam eden süreçte dünya, iklim değişimlerinin yaşandığı, doğal yaşam koşullarının değiştiği yeni bir döneme girmiştir. Çevreciler, işletmelerin ve tüketicilerin karbon emisyonları ile küresel ısınma üzerindeki etkilerini sorgulamakta ve iklim değişimlerini doğanın insanlığa bir uyarısı olarak görmektedirler. Tükenmekte olan kaynaklar ile başlayan çevresel sorunlar öngörülemeyen birtakım problemlerin doğmasına yol açmıştır. Her endüstri kullandığı petrol ürününe karşı bir alternatif aramakta ve yenilenemeyen petrol bazlı ürünlerden uzaklaşmaktadır. Basım endüstrisinde ise sürdürülebilirlik, bir tesisin, ürünün, sürecin tüm yönlerini kapsayan bütüncül bir yaklaşım olarak yalnızca çevre için olumlu değişikliklerle sınırlı kalmayıp, çalışanların sağlık ve güvenliğini tüm iş kanunları ile birlikte korumayı hedeflemektedir. Basım endüstrisindeki birçok matbaa, tüketici ve markaların talepleri doğrultusunda sürdürülebilirlik konusunu misyon edinip, sürdürülebilir üretim yaklaşımı üzerine çalışmalar yapmaktadır. Bu tez çalışmasında, basım endüstrisinde ofset baskı tekniği ile üretilen bir ürün olan karton etiketin, üretiminde kullanılan kâğıt ve mürekkep gibi temel hammaddelerin, üretimden tüketime ve sonrasında geri dönüşüme kadar giden yolculuğunda doğaya bıraktığı toplam sera gazı emisyonunun birim karbondioksit cinsinden miktarı olan karbon ayak izi, ekonomik maliyeti, üretim tekniklerinin özellikleri incelenerek bir tez çalışması yürütülmüştür. Bulunan veriler üzerinden bir program ile çok değişkenli karar verme metodu ile sürdürülebilirlik skorları hesaplanmıştır. Birden fazla türde kâğıt, mürekkep gibi farklı hammaddeler dikkate alınarak aralarından hangi kombinasyonun daha sürdürülebilir olduğu sayısal olarak hesaplanmış ve optimum üretim yöntemi belirlenmiştir.
ABSTRACTSUSTAINABILITY IN PRINTING INDUSTRY: A STUDY ON CARDBOARD LABEL PRODUCTIONIn the process of human development, the world has entered a new era in which climate change is faced and natural living conditions have changed. Environmentalists question the impacts of companies and consumers about the carbon emissions and global warming, and they see climate change as a warning of nature to humanity. Environmental problems starting with resource depletion have led to a number of unpredictable problems. Every industry is looking for an alternative solution to the petroleum products it uses and is moving away from non-renewable petroleum-based products. In the printing industry, sustainability requires a holistic approach that encompasses all aspects of a plant, product, and process, not only making positive changes to the environment, but also ensuring that the requirements of health and safety of employees are fulfilled with all labor laws. In line with the demands of consumers and brands, many printing houses in the printing industry adopt sustainability as a mission and work on a sustainable production approach.In this thesis, the carbon footprint, which is the amount of the total greenhouse gas emissions in unit carbon dioxide, that the basic raw materials such as paper and ink used in the production of the cardboard label, which is a product produced with the offset printing technique in the printing industry, on its journey from production to consumption and then to recycling, was determined. The study was carried out by examining the economic cost and the characteristics of production techniques. Sustainability scores were calculated using MCDA methods with a program based on the data found. Considering different raw materials such as more than one type of paper and ink, which combination is more sustainable was calculated numerically and the optimum production method was determined.
